Jeff Galloway writes: > Compiler error message: > > fork.c: In function Œcopy_mm¹: > fork.c:353: fixed or forbidden register 68 (0) was spilled for class > CR0_REGS. > This may be due to a compiler bug or to impossible asm statements or > clauses. You need a newer gcc, I suspect you have egcs i
